U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) is responsible for enforcing immigration and customs laws within the United States. Their duties include identifying and addressing immigration violations, deporting individuals who are in the country illegally, and combating transnational criminal organizations. ICE also plays a role in securing borders and investigating various forms of illegal activity related to immigration. They are a significant agency in the immigration system.

The 1924 Immigration Act, also known as the Johnson-Reed Act, established a national origins quota system for immigrants. This system heavily favored immigrants from Northern and Western Europe while severely restricting those from Southern and Eastern Europe and banning most Asians. It significantly shaped U.S. immigration policy for decades by prioritizing certain nationalities. Its impact was profound on the demographics of immigration.

An immigration judge presides over immigration court hearings, making decisions on cases involving deportation, asylum, and other immigration relief. They ensure that immigration laws are applied fairly and that due process is followed. The judge reviews evidence presented by both the government and the immigrant and then makes a ruling. Their role is critical in determining an individual's immigration status.
